Or alternatively October openSUSE 13.2 - openSUSE release March openSUSE 13.2 sp 1 - tumbleweed snapshot 1 July openSUSE 13.2 sp 2 - tumbleweed snapshot 2
We can use 13.{1,2,3) to mark release and then next two snapshots. That will finally make use of .{1,2,3} in a way that is consistent with other software. There is another reason to release snapshots. People that download CD, or DVD, have huge pile of updates right after installation. Snapshots will cut down on that. -- Regards, Rajko. -- To unsubscribe, e-mail: opensuse-project+unsubscribe@opensuse.org To contact the owner, email: opensuse-project+owner@opensuse.org
